About the course
The Doctor of Philosophy in Family and Consumer Sciences Education (FCSE) prepares individuals for faculty positions in higher education and other professional leadership roles. The Ph.D. requires a minimum of 60 semester hours, exclusive of dissertation. Admission to the FCSE doctoral program requires a master’s degree from an accredited institution. The FCSE doctoral program can be completed either on the Lubbock campus or at a distance. Both options require students to attend a two-day, face-to-face orientation at the beginning of the program. Entry requirements for Texas Tech University
Résumé (current contact information, summary of educational and professional background, names and contact information for three individuals sending letters of reference)
Written statement of professional interest and intent indicating interest in and unique contributions to FCSE doctoral program
Writing sample
Three letters of recommendation addressing professional background, academic performance, and potential for success in a doctoral program
Official transcripts (include all institutions attended)
